Leak and Fire incident at Marathon Refinery in Garyville


Emergency crews responded to a Fire and leak at Marathon Petroleum in Garyville Friday morning.

The company tells WDSU that local emergency responders are currently responding to a naphtha release and fire at a storage tank at the St. John the Baptist Refinery.

A mandatory evacuation was ordered but has since been lifted.

The fire is currently under control and has remained within the common containment dike area of two tanks on the refinery’s property, according to Parish Officials.

Both tanks have sustained damage.

Crews are remaining on site, and an investigation into the cause of the fire is ongoing.

The full statement from Marathon can be read here:

“Marathon Petroleum personnel and local emergency responders are currently responding to a naphtha release and fire at a storage tank at the company’s Garyville, Louisiana, refinery. The release and fire are contained within the refinery’s property and there have been no injuries. As a precaution, air monitoring has been deployed in the community. No off-site impacts have been detected. “

“All regulatory notifications have been made. As always, our main priority is to ensure the safety of our employees and contractors, our neighbors within our surrounding community, first responders, and to limit environmental impact. An investigation will be conducted to determine the cause of the release.”

St. John Preparatory Academy has been placed under lockdown due to the fire.

Garyville/Mt. Airy Math and Science Magnet School, also known as GMMS, is releasing immediately, with district transportation bringing home students who normally ride the bus.

Parents and guardians are asked to pick up students immediately, according to parish officials.
